ED arrested Bhupendra Saran in Rajasthan Paper Leak Case

New Delhi. ED has arrested Bhupendra Saran under the provisions of PMLA, 2002 on 09.10.2023 in the matter of Paper Leak case in Rajasthan. He was produced before the Hon’ble Special Court PMLA, Jaipur and the Special Court granted 03 days ED Custody. ED initiated investigation on the basis of FIRs/Charge-sheets registered/filed by Rajasthan Police, under various sections of IPC against Bhupendra Saran and other related persons.

ED investigation revealed that Bhupendra Saran in connivance with other persons leaked the question paper of General Knowledge of Senior Teacher Grade II Competitive Examination, 2022 which was scheduled to be conducted by RPSC on 21.12.2022, 22.12.2022 and 24.12.2022 at various places in Rajasthan. Further, Bhupendra Saran supplied the said leaked papers to Suresh Dhaka and other persons/candidates for the consideration amount of Rs. 8 to 10 lakh per candidate.

ED has earlier conducted search at 15 premises of accused persons on 05.06.2023, resulting in search operation various incriminating documents and digital records were seized. Further, ED has also provisionally attached movable & immovable properties worth Rs. 3,11,93,597.88/- of Bhupendra Saran and others vide Provisional Attachment Order dated 18.08.2023. ED had earlier arrested two accused persons Babulal Katara and Anil Kumar Meena AKA Sher Singh Meena.
